思科链路优化的代码
时间: 2023-08-11 14:16:15 浏览: 45
思科设备上实现链路优化的方式有很多,最常用的方法是配置OSPF区域类型和LSA过滤。下面是一个简单的思科路由器OSPF配置示例,用于实现链路优化:
```
Router(config)# router ospf 1
Router(config-router)# network 10.0.0.0 0.255.255.255 area 0
Router(config-router)# area 1 stub
Router(config-router)# area 2 stub no-summary
Router(config-router)# area 3 nssa
Router(config-router)# area 4 nssa no-summary
Router(config-router)# distribute-list prefix-list out
```
上述配置中,我们首先启用OSPF进程,并将10.0.0.0/8网络区域0中的所有路由器都添加到该进程中。然后,我们为四个不同的区域配置了不同的类型:
- 区域1被配置为Stub区域,这意味着该区域中的所有路由器都只会收到默认路由和本地接口的路由。
- 区域2被配置为Stub No-Summary区域,这意味着该区域中的所有路由器都只会收到默认路由和本地接口的路由,并且该区域不会向其他区域汇报摘要路由。
- 区域3被配置为NSSA区域,这意味着该区域中的所有路由器都可以收到外部路由(例如,从ASBR进入该区域的路由),但该区域不会向其他区域汇报这些外部路由。
- 区域4被配置为NSSA No-Summary区域,这意味着该区域中的所有路由器都可以收到外部路由,但该区域不会向其他区域汇报这些外部路由,并且该区域不会向其他区域汇报摘要路由。
最后,我们使用distribute-list命令配置了一个前缀列表,用于过滤出向该区域汇报的LSA。这可以帮助减少LSA的数量,从而提高网络性能。
请注意,这只是一个简单的示例,实际的OSPF配置可能会更加复杂,并且需要根据网络拓扑和性能需求进行调整。